CC -!- FUNCTION: Mediates the nuclear export of cellular proteins
CC (cargos) bearing a leucine-rich nuclear export signal (NES).
CC -!- SUBUNIT: Component of a nuclear export receptor complex (By
CC similarity).
CC -!- SUBCELLULAR LOCATION: Nucleus (By similarity). Cytoplasm,
CC perinuclear region (By similarity). Note=Shuttles between the
CC nucleus and the cytoplasm (By similarity).
CC -!- SIMILARITY: Belongs to the exportin family.
CC -!- SIMILARITY: Contains 11 HEAT repeats.
CC -!- SIMILARITY: Contains 1 importin N-terminal domain.
